Lobster & Bacon Tacos with Old Bay Crema

These tacos filled with sweet, succulent Maine lobster meat, crispy bits of bacon, creamy avocado and finely shredded crunchy cabbage are a new summer favorite of mine.

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 5 minutes
Servings 4
Calories 1019kcal

Ingredients

For the Old Bay crema: 

  • 1/4 cup sour cream
  • 1/4 cup mayonnaise
  • 1 teaspoon Old Bay® seasoning 
  • 1 teaspoon paprika

For the lobster & bacon filling:

  • 1 pound thick-cut bacon
  • 1 pound cooked knuckle and claw Maine lobster meat, roughly chopped
  • 2 tablespoons unsalted butter, melted
  • 8 small corn tortillas, warmed
  • 2 cups finely shredded green cabbage
  • 2 medium Haas avocados, pitted peeled and sliced 

Instructions

For the Old Bay crema: 

  • In a medium mixing bowl whisk together the sour cream, mayonnaise, Old Bay, paprika and 2 tablespoons of water until combined. Cover and refrigerate until ready to use. 

For the lobster & bacon filling: 

  • Add the bacon to a large non-stick skillet. Heat over medium heat, cooking until the bacon fat is rendered and the bacon is crispy, about 5 minutes. Use a slotted spoon to remove the bacon to a paper towel lined plate.
  • In a medium bowl gently mix together the lobster, butter and cooked bacon until combined.
  • Top each tortilla with a small handful of the cabbage and top with a scoop of the lobster and bacon. Top with slices of avocado and drizzle with the old bay crema. Serve immediately.
